Bradford-on-Avon station makes traveling easier with several facilities designed for your convenience. The ticket office is open from 06:20 to 13:30 on weekdays and Saturdays, ensuring you can easily purchase or collect your tickets from the machines available. Accessibility is prioritized with step-free access to platforms, though access to platform 1 requires a trip through local streets and via a ramp. While there are no toilets or refreshment areas on-site, the station provides an induction loop and accessible ticket machines, making it accommodating for passengers with various needs. The station also has a waiting room incorporated within the ticket office, available during opening hours.
Bradford-on-Avon is well-connected to several transport links facilitating easy travel beyond the station. A taxi office sits just outside the station, ready to whisk you off to your next local destination. If you prefer a more cost-effective form of onwards travel, hop on one of the local buses, or plan your journey in advance with the available online resources. For those catching flights, you'll find connections via Reading to Heathrow and Gatwick, or through Bristol Temple Meads if you're heading to Bristol Airport.
Cyclists will be pleased to know bicycle hire is available, with additional information accessible through the Towpath Trailtowpath service located in the town center, offering an eco-friendly means to discover Bradford-on-Avon.

Ravensbourne Station is equipped to handle your ticketing needs efficiently, making travel planning less cumbersome. The ticket office is open Monday to Friday from 06:40 to 13:20. If you are traveling outside these hours, don’t fret—automated ticket machines are available, and they support online ticket collection. These machines are accessible and offer discounts for travelers with a Disabled Persons Railcard, although it’s important to check the station map for step-free access to ensure a smooth journey.
Although the station lacks some conveniences such as waiting rooms or toilets, it compensates with functional seating areas and customer help points for any queries. If you're worried about security, rest assured, as all areas are monitored by CCTV. Ravensbourne also strives to be inclusive with features like induction loops and staff assistance available during ticket office hours.
For those considering onward travel from Ravensbourne, numerous transport options await. The station is interconnected with local bus services, and more details can be accessed from the 'Onward Travel Information Map' at the station. While taxi and car hire services are not directly available at the station, nearby options can get you to your destination efficiently.
